Asking managements of private colleges to step up and agitate against the Telangana government for the release of fee reimbursement arrears, Telangana Pradesh Congress Committee President (TPCC) N Uttam Kumar Reddy said that K Chandrashekar Rao became Chief Minister of Telangana State only due to the students who had risen up for the cause of Telangana's Statehood.
Participating in Vidhyarthi Poru Garjana at Taher Garden on Friday, the TPCC chief claimed that the State government's apathy forced the closure of 3,200 colleges.
Reddy demanded that the State government release funds towards fee reimbursement immediately.
